Subtract 5/18 from 42/27
1st number: 1 15/27, 2nd number: 5/18
42/27 - 5/18 is 23/18.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 27 and 18 is 54
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 54 - For the 1st fraction, since 27 × 2 = 54,
42/27 = 42 × 2/27 × 2 = 84/54 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 18 × 3 = 54,
5/18 = 5 × 3/18 × 3 = 15/54 - Subtract the two like fractions:
84/54 - 15/54 = 84 - 15/54 = 69/54 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 23/18
